When two objects are rubbed with each other, approximately a charge of 50 nC can be produced in each object. Calculate the number of electrons that must be transferred to produce this charge.

Answer»

Charge produced in each object q = 50 nC 

q = 50 x 10-9

Charge of electron (e) = 1.6 x 10-9

Number of electron transferred, n = \(\frac {q}{e}\)\(\frac {50 \times 10^{-9}}{1.6 \times 10^{-19}}\) 

=31. 25 × 10-9 × 1019 

n = 31.25 x 1010 

electrons 

Ans. n = 31.25 x 1010 electrons
